Merge "Temporarily disable 'Scan Always' mode" into jb-mr2-dev
This commit is contained in:
committed by
Android (Google) Code Review
commit
93647e2f8f
@@ -379,6 +379,9 @@ class WifiController extends StateMachine {
|
||||
|
||||
@Override
|
||||
public void enter() {
|
||||
|
||||
if (DBG) logd("Going to disabled without scan state");
|
||||
|
||||
mWifiStateMachine.setSupplicantRunning(false);
|
||||
// Supplicant can't restart right away, so not the time we switched off
|
||||
mDisabledTimestamp = SystemClock.elapsedRealtime();
|
||||
@@ -496,6 +499,9 @@ class WifiController extends StateMachine {
|
||||
|
||||
@Override
|
||||
public void enter() {
|
||||
|
||||
if (DBG) logd("Enabling disabled with scan state");
|
||||
|
||||
mWifiStateMachine.setSupplicantRunning(true);
|
||||
mWifiStateMachine.setOperationalMode(WifiStateMachine.SCAN_ONLY_WITH_WIFI_OFF_MODE);
|
||||
mWifiStateMachine.setDriverStart(true);
|
||||
|
||||
@@ -51,7 +51,7 @@ final class WifiSettingsStore {
|
||||
mContext = context;
|
||||
mAirplaneModeOn = getPersistedAirplaneModeOn();
|
||||
mPersistWifiState = getPersistedWifiState();
|
||||
mScanAlwaysAvailable = getPersistedScanAlwaysAvailable();
|
||||
mScanAlwaysAvailable = false; // getPersistedScanAlwaysAvailable();
|
||||
}
|
||||
|
||||
synchronized boolean isWifiToggleEnabled() {
|
||||
@@ -124,7 +124,8 @@ final class WifiSettingsStore {
|
||||
}
|
||||
|
||||
synchronized void handleWifiScanAlwaysAvailableToggled() {
|
||||
mScanAlwaysAvailable = getPersistedScanAlwaysAvailable();
|
||||
// mScanAlwaysAvailable = getPersistedScanAlwaysAvailable();
|
||||
mScanAlwaysAvailable = false;
|
||||
}
|
||||
|
||||
void dump(FileDescriptor fd, PrintWriter pw, String[] args) {
|
||||
|
||||
Reference in New Issue
Block a user